Lenovo S5 Official in Nepal with Dual Camera and 4GB of RAM

Lenovo S5

Chinese multinational company, Lenovo launched the two budget smartphones in Nepal, Lenovo K5 Play and Lenovo S5. In this article we are going after the specs of Lenovo S5.  Lenovo S5 is the new budget category of smartphone and comes with Dual rear camera setup and 4GB of RAM. Ambe Mobiles Pvt.Ltd launched the Lenovo K5 Play and Lenovo S5 on October 30 in Nepal.

Lenovo S5 comes with 5.7 inches of IPS LCD FUll HD+ (max vision display) that measures the HD screen resolution of 1080 x 2160 pixels. Phone doesn’t have the any elegant looks as it has same design model found in 2017. Lenovo S5 is powered by Snapdragon 625 Octa-core processor and is coupled with 4GB of RAM and 64GB of internal memory, which is expandable upto 128GB through the microSD. Phone currently runs Android 8.0 Oreo as the main software of the phone.

Talking about the camera of the phone, Lenovo S5 has 16MP of front facing camera and is setup with f/2.2 aperture of lens. Similarly, Noticing the rear camera, Lenovo S5 has dual camera setup of 13MP each and is setup with f/2.2 aperture of lens. Phone has monochrome sensor at rear. The phone houses the 3000 mAh of battery power and also features rear-mounted fingerprint sensor.

Lenovo S5 Price in Nepal:

In Nepal, Lenovo S5 is available for Rs.26,999. In compare to specs it has got, the price range of the phone doesn’t seems to be too high or too low as well.

Key Specs Highlights of Lenovo S5:

Display: 5.7″ IPS LCD FUll HD+ Max Vision Display
Resolution: 1080 x 2160
Processor: Snapdragon 625 Octa-core
OS: Android 8.0 Oreo
RAM: 4GB
Internal Memory: 64GB (expandable upto 128GB)
Battery: 3000 mAh
Front Camera: 16MP, f/2.2
Rear Camera: Dual 13MP, f/2.2 + 13MP, monochrome sensor
Price: Rs.26,999
